If you're ever accused of a crime, getting arrested and spending time in jail can be an unfamiliar and frightening experience. Fortunately, since you are legally innocent until proven guilty, in many cases a judge may provide you with released until your hearing or trial. However, the judge may order that you provide some form of guarantee that you will return to face prices come against you before you'll be released from custody. This security is called a Bail Bond, and it must have to usually be turned over to the court in the form of cash, property, a signature bond, a secured bond through a surety company, or a combination of forms.

Bail bonds are commonly set during an official procedure called a bail hearing. And here the Judge meets with the accused person (Defendant) and hears information about whether or not it is appropriate to set bail. If certain types of bail bonds are being considered, like a secured bond or property bond, the Judge will consider concerning the Defendant's financial resources and the involving whatever property or funds will be harnessed for collateral for the bail bond. If anyone else will be posting bail for the Defendant, they are viewed as a Surety and their spending budget will also be regarded.

If a Surety is involved in providing bail, he or she must be present in the bail hearing considering the Defendant, and the Judge will inform both of them about their various obligations and responsibilities. It is very important to keep in mind that if the Defendant does not fulfill his responsibilities and peruse for subsequent hearings and court dates, or if he violates any conditions of his release, the bail might be revoked and forfeited. So it is very important that the Surety has confidence in the Defendant before posting help.

Once the bail has been set, it is important to understand the various bail options. "Cash" bail may include cash, but it can certainly usually also be paid by certified checks, cashier' s checks or money orders. It is very important for whoever posts the cash bail to keep the receipt they receive so that they should be able to collect their refund the particular terms of the bail have been met. Depending on the amount of cash bail, it may also be necessary for the Defendant or Surety to complete tax forms like IRS Form W-9 too.

Unlike cash bail, signature bonds end up with a Defendant doesn't have to post any funds or property as security. Usually the Defendant only end up being sign the proper forms for a legal court clerk in order to be circulated. But it is very important expend close attention for any conditions or instructions that the Judge has given to ensure that Defendant understands just what he must achieve that his bail is not shut down.

Corporate Surety Bonds are bail bonds that are secured by Bail bondsmen. Usually the Defendant or the Surety pays 10% of this total bail comprise the bondsman, as well as the Defendant or the Surety must have sufficient financial assets which could pay the remainder of the bond if the bail is revoked or if the Defendant does not meet the conditions of his help. Even if the Defendant does meet all of his bail conditions, the 10% remains the house or property of the bail bondsman and isn't returned to the defendant.

Sometimes a Judge may approve Property bonds as collateral to secure a bond. Usually the Judge will require that the Defendant or Surety provide proof of ownership of the property, as well a great appraisal of value, and a associated with any existing claims or other encumbrances against the property.

Once the conditions of bail also been met, the bail may be released or returned. However, it is donrrrt forget that this doesn't happen automatically. Usually the Surety, the Defendant or the Defendant's attorney will would be wise to file a motion or take some other action to recover the cash or property securing the bail. So look for with the procedures in your case and make sure the proper steps are followed to give the bail returned on the appropriate person.
